13 New Abbey , Castlemartin Lodge , Kilcullen
Proposed development
for construction of a storey and a half extension to the side of an existing two and a half storey dwelling to provide for a family flat with an overall floor area of 84m2 along with all associated site development and facilitating works
What happens next
Permission was granted on 15 Jan 2026. Third parties may appeal within four weeks; after that the permission is final and works can start once a commencement notice is lodged.
